Skip to content

Percona Server for MongoDB 5.0.17-14 (2023-05-04)

Release date May 4, 2023
Installation Installing Percona Server for MongoDB

Percona Server for MongoDB 5.0.17-14 is an enhanced, source-available, and highly-scalable database that is a fully-compatible, drop-in replacement for MongoDB 5.0.16 Community Edition and MongoDB 5.0.17 Community Edition.

It supports protocols and drivers of both MongoDB 5.0.16 and 5.0.17.

This release of Percona Server for MongoDB includes the improvements and bug fixes of MongoDB Community Edition 5.0.16 and 5.0.17.

Release Highlights

The bug fixes, provided by MongoDB and included in Percona Server for MongoDB, are the following:

  • SERVER-61909 - Fixed a hang when inserting or deleting a document with large number of index entries
  • SERVER-73822 - Fixed the failing $group min-max rewrite logic for time-series collections when there is a non-constant expression
  • SERVER-74501 - Fixed MigrationBatchFetcher/Inserter completion reliance to not spawn an extra cleanup thread
  • SERVER-75205 - Fixed deadlock between stepdown and restoring locks after yielding when all read tickets exhausted
  • SERVER-73229 - Fixed the issue with early kills of the cursor during the logical session cache refresh by properly handling write errors.
  • SERVER-75261 - Added accounting for array element overhead for listCollections, listIndexes, _shardsvrCheckMetadataConsistencyParticipant commands
  • SERVER-75431 - Improved the rename path behavior for a collection in sharded clusters by fixing the check for the databases to reside on the same primary shard
  • SERVER-76098 - Allowed queries with search and non-simple collations

Find the full list of changes in the MongoDB 5.0.16 Community Edition and MongoDB 5.0.17 Community Edition release notes.

Bugs Fixed

  • PSMDB-1211: Improved the master key rotation handling in case of failure
  • PSMDB-1231: Register a master key for data-at-rest encryption encryption on the KMIP server in the raw-bytes form
  • PSMDB-1239: Fixed the issue with PSMDB failing to restart when wrong data-at-rest encryption options were used during the previous start

Get expert help

If you need assistance, visit the community forum for comprehensive and free database knowledge, or contact our Percona Database Experts for professional support and services.